6,560 Shares in Prudential Financial, Inc. $PRU Purchased by Global Retirement Partners LLC

Global Retirement Partners LLC purchased a new position in Prudential Financial, Inc. (NYSE:PRUFree Report) during the second qu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The fund purchased 6,560 shares of the financial services provider’s stock, valued at approximately $708,000.

Prudential Financial Stock Performance

PRU stock opened at $124.55 on Wednesday. Prudential Financial, Inc. has a twelve month low of $91.89 and a twelve month high of $127.72. The firm has a market cap of $42.97 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 11.28, a PEG ratio of 2.38 and a beta of 0.84. The business’s fifty day simple moving average is $115.78 and its two-hundred day simple moving average is $105.44. The company has a quick ratio of 0.16, a current ratio of 0.16 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.62.

Prudential Financial (NYSE:PRUG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, August 4th. The financial services provider reported $4.08 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$3.52 by $0.56. The firm had revenue of $14.15 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$14.36 billion. Prudential Financial had a net margin of 6.51% and a return on equity of 16.68%. During the same period in the prior year, the business posted $3.58 earnings per share. Analysts predict that Prudential Financial, Inc. will post 14.17 earnings per share for the current year.

Prudential Financial Announces Dividend

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, September 10th. Investors of record on Tuesday, August 25th will be issued a $1.40 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, August 25th. This represents a $5.60 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 4.5%. Prudential Financial’s payout ratio is presently 50.72%.

Prudential Financial Company Profile

Prudential Financial, Inc, headquartered in Newark, New Jersey, is a diversified financial services company with roots dating to 1875. The firm provides a range of insurance, retirement and investment products aimed at helping individual and institutional clients manage risk, accumulate and protect wealth, and plan for retirement. Prudential’s long history in life insurance and related financial services has positioned it as a major participant in the U.S. insurance market and a provider of services to a broad client base.

Prudential’s core business activities include individual life insurance, annuities, retirement solutions and group insurance products for employers.
